Toya Manchineri in Acre, Brazil
Toya Manchineri, Coordinator of Territories and Natural Resources for the Coordination of Indigenous Organizations in the Amazon Basin (COICA).
In addition to diseases, such as Covid-19, the indigenous populations of the state have compromised their diet due to the destruction of subsistence plantations. Some villages were completely submerged after flooding the rivers.
About 1,5 tonnes of food, water and cleaning and hygiene materials were delivered to the indigenous peoples of Acre, who are currently facing the coronavirus pandemic, floods and dengue outbreaks. Greenpeace Brazil partnership signed with COIAB (Coordination of Indigenous Organizations in the Brazilian Amazon), Project Delivery, Idesam, COICA (Coordination of Indigenous Organizations in the Amazon Basin) and Água Crim.
